About Yichuan Chen
Yichuan Chen is a scholar working on Electrical and Electronic Engineering, Materials Chemistry, Polymers and Plastics, Biomedical Engineering and Electronic, Optical and Magnetic Materials, having authored 79 papers that have together received 2.0k indexed citations. Recurring topics across this work include Perovskite Materials and Applications (18 papers), Quantum Dots Synthesis And Properties (12 papers), Chalcogenide Semiconductor Thin Films (12 papers), Conducting polymers and applications (11 papers), ZnO doping and properties (11 papers), Copper-based nanomaterials and applications (7 papers), Advanced Sensor and Energy Harvesting Materials (6 papers) and Nanomaterials and Printing Technologies (6 papers). The work is most often cited by research in Polymers and Plastics (492 citations), Materials Chemistry (1.1k citations), Electrical and Electronic Engineering (1.3k citations), Renewable Energy, Sustainability and the Environment (203 citations) and Electronic, Optical and Magnetic Materials (160 citations). Yichuan Chen has collaborated with scholars based in China, Taiwan and United States. Frequent co-authors include Hui Yan, Mengtao Sun, Hongli Gao, Qi Meng, Yongzhe Zhang, Panagiotis G. Smirniotis, Chang Bao Han, Yongzhe Zhang, Linrui Zhang and Nabonswendé Aïda Nadège Ouedraogo. Their work appears in journals such as Journal of Materials Science Materials in Electronics, The Journal of Physical Chemistry C, RSC Advances, Nanoscale and Process Biochemistry.
